GCSE Art Exam 2012Extraordinary

Extraordinary

O Remember the title is only a starting point

O My advice is to stick to Extraordinary.O You have 8 weeks to research

develop and refine ideas and prepare for the exam days.

O You will have 10 hours to complete a final piece or pieces.

Task 1- Mind map

O Create a Mind Map to show the areas you could look at .

O The next slide has some suggestions

Examples for research areas

O Landscapes - Strange formations O People- extraordinary feats O Events – eg, extreme weatherO Buildings – cutting edge ArchitectureO Animals/insects – Close upsO Plants – exotic plants -Close upsO Sea Life/Coral – Close ups

Task 2 Artist research O Look at the artist/ movement/

architect/designer suggested or areas you would like to research this may come from your mind map

Artists/ Designers O The exam paper has some suggestions and you

can look at artists you have already studied. Eg. O Dali- mad landscapes from dreams and

nightmares O Magritte- Odd mixture of well known objects O Max Ernst- Surrealism O Roger Dean- Fantasy Landscapes O John Martin – huge apocalyptic canvases O Fashion - Zandra Rhodes, Vivienne Westwood

O Max Ernst-

Dali

Magritte

Roger Dean

Yves Tanguy

Task O Choose one of the Artists and

produce at least 4 pages A4 of research and examples.

O This will form one of the research topics.

O Don’t worry if you already have studied one artist you can use as many as you need.

O You must annotate the examples and display in relevant and creative manner showing you have explored the artists style.

Task 3 O You need evidence of Primary and

Secondary(found) examplesO Primary Resource; You must provide evidence

of your own drawings (from objects) and/or images you have taken your self.

O Presentation and display of this is very important.

O Experiment with display and recording and ideas

O Record all experiments for marking
